- Brownbag Lectures: Diagnosing the Whole Patient: Using Poverty Simulation to Help Residents See Beyond Medical Issues
- ISM Research & Collections Center
Wednesday, May 22, 2013, 12:00 PM - 1:00 PM
Presented by: Jacqueline Ferguson, MA; Andrew Varney, MD; and Ross Silverman, JD Southern Illinois University School of Medicine
Physicians-in-training (residents) can lose compassion for, and understanding of, their patients as residents attempt to master their chosen profession.To combat this lack of understanding and compassion, resident physicians at Southern Illinois University School of Medicine participated in an interactive poverty simulation designed to: (a) teach them the issues facing people living in poverty, (b) help them understand the issues that prevent patients from being compliant, and (c) help them become more compassionate toward the poor and poverty-stricken.
